In «Hobomok,» Lydia Maria Child weaves a compelling narrative that intertwines themes of race, identity, and cultural conflict in early America. Set against the backdrop of 17th-century Massachusetts, the novel follows the story of Mary, a young Puritan woman, and her relationship with Hobomok, a Native American man. Through vivid imagery and lyrical prose, Child captures the complexities of colonial life and the often fraught encounters between indigenous peoples and European settlers.
